One of the primary reasons for regular service in electrical systems is safety. Faulty wiring, overloaded circuits, and other electrical issues can pose serious fire hazards if left unchecked. By inspecting and maintaining electrical systems on a regular basis, potential safety risks can be identified and addressed before they lead to dangerous situations. This not only protects people and property but also ensures compliance with electrical codes and regulations.

In addition to safety, regular service in electrical systems can also improve energy efficiency. Over time, electrical systems can become less efficient due to factors like wear and tear, dust buildup, and outdated equipment. By performing routine maintenance and upgrades, energy consumption can be optimized, resulting in lower utility bills and reduced environmental impact. Services like electrical panel upgrades, LED lighting installation, and energy audits can help businesses and homeowners make their electrical systems more sustainable and cost-effective.

Another benefit of service in electrical systems is increased reliability. Electrical outages can be disruptive and costly, leading to downtime, spoiled inventory, lost revenue, and inconvenience for occupants. By maintaining electrical systems properly, the risk of unplanned downtime can be minimized, ensuring that critical operations continue to run smoothly. This is particularly important for businesses that rely on uninterrupted power supply for their day-to-day operations.
